How Long It Takes
Plan for a typical backyard remodeling project in Issaquah to take 6–12 weeks, depending on features. Simpler compact layouts may finish in less than two months, while luxury builds with full plumbing require more time.

Winterizing Your Outdoor Kitchen in Issaquah, WA
Shielding your backyard culinary area from the damp, chilly seasonal moisture is critical. Begin by shutting off water lines to prevent freezing, especially for outdoor refrigeration units. Cover all appliances and store removable components; consider adding heated enclosures to vulnerable zones. A well-winterized kitchen ensures reliable backyard functionality.

Plumbing and Power Rules in Western WA Installations
Plumbing gas, water, or electricity to your exterior kitchen must follow Issaquah utility codes. Natural gas lines require a certified plumber, while electrical circuits need GFCI protection and underground conduit. For waterproof outdoor sinks, backflow prevention is mandatory.
